Job summary

Blue Origin is seeking an experienced engineer to support the development of New Glenn, a reusable orbital launch vehicle. You will be responsible for the development and integration of critical LRU assemblies, ensuring compliance with strict quality standards.

The ideal candidate has strong problem-solving skills, a Bachelor's degree in electrical or computer engineering, and at least 3 years of hands-on experience in electronic assembly development. The role offers a competitive salary and benefits including stock options and healthcare.

Qualifications

  • Minimum of 3+ years developing and testing complex hardware equipment.
  • Direct hands-on experience in developing electronic assemblies.
  • Passion for avionics integration and test.
  • Ability to work independently on rapid development programs.
  • Highly organized with excellent communication skills.

Responsibilities

  • Own the development and integration of LRU assemblies for Embedded Controllers.
  • Conduct qualification testing in extreme environments as per military standards.
  • Support stakeholders with requirement definition and verification activities.
  • Collaborate with subsystems to identify current technology capabilities.
